150kw Air Cooled Condenser for A Refrigeration System
An air-cooled condenser is a key component of a refrigeration system, responsible for rejecting heat from the refrigerant to the ambient air. It plays a crucial role in maintaining the efficiency and effectiveness of the refrigeration cycle, especially in applications where water availability is limited or water-cooled systems are not feasible.
Design and Operation
Components:
Condenser Coil: Typically made of copper tubes with aluminum fins to enhance heat transfer. The refrigerant flows through these tubes.
Fans: Mounted to force ambient air over the condenser coil, increasing the rate of heat dissipation.
Casing: Encloses the coil and fans, often designed to direct airflow efficiently and protect internal components.
Operation:
Heat Rejection: Hot, high-pressure refrigerant vapor from the compressor enters the condenser coil.
Condensation: As the refrigerant flows through the coil, the fans draw or blow ambient air over the coil's surface. The temperature difference between the hot refrigerant and the cooler ambient air causes the refrigerant to release its heat and condense into a high-pressure liquid.
Airflow Direction: Can be vertical or horizontal, depending on the design. Vertical discharge is common in rooftop units, while horizontal discharge is typical for ground-mounted units.
